...work of the various squads is somewhat as follows. They first go through a short, sharp dumb-bell exercise, which is intended to liven them up and get their muscles into a pliable condition. Immediately after this they go to the rowing room, where they are put to work on the machines for about half an hour. Particular attention is paid to their body positions and to making them row together. Work on the machines is followed by a run, always in the open air unless the weather is particularly bad. The crews are taking rather longer runs than usual...
